Subject: Nightly reindex — what to expect

The Lanternwood search reindex kicks off at 02:00 and usually finishes within an hour. If it overruns, queries degrade gracefully to the stale index, so there's no immediate user impact. Check the job log before restarting anything; duplicate runs cause lock contention. The full procedure and failure modes are written up on this page.

runbook for badug-kadup: https://confluence.zemvarlabs.internal/projects/browse/display/projects/bd1b

## Authentication

VramScope's profiling agent authenticates against the Kestrelworks telemetry gateway before uploading GPU memory traces. All requests are signed and transmitted over mutual TLS; the agent refuses to start if the trust bundle is stale. For audit purposes, every upload is tagged with the issuing team and retention class. Reviewers should confirm the key below is scoped read-write to the profiling namespace only. The current key is:

API key for yahig-tadup: kto7_ubizbYm

Handover: Quayle image slimming

From: Dmitra, to: Hallis.

Base image trimmed from 1.2GB to 310MB. Dropped build toolchain, switched to the minimal Ostrel runtime layer. Two gotchas: the PDF renderer needs libharfen manually copied in, and healthchecks break if you strip curl. Pipeline config is in the slim-build branch; don't merge until the Verano team signs off on their sidecar.

The signing keystore for the registry push is sealed; if CI loses its session you'll need to unseal it manually with the passphrase below.

vault phrase of tajeg-tageg = pelix-druix-holius-briael-zorwyn-frawyn-fraox-norok-drueth-aldiel

Handover note, Priya-of-Quellworks to Damen. The Fixtureloom test-data factory now seeds deterministic records for all Marrowtide release suites; builders are versioned, so pin v4 before the cut. I've documented the seed rotation steps in the release folder. One last item: the encrypted seed archive needs unlocking before first use, and the recovery passphrase is listed below.

vault phrase of tajop-haduf = holath-brivan-wenax